      As I said above with the latest version I mount the root directory with \\sshfs.r\user@host

      However, if you want to mount another directory like /var/www you have to do:
      \\sshfs.r\user@host\var\www\
      The trailing \ is very important!
      It just doesn't work without it if your path is more than one directory deep. You also need to use backslash and not the forward slash.

      Of interesting note: In Windows NT4 and Windows 2000, Interix / WSU were "add on" components for Windows. But starting with 2003 R2 and going through 2008 R2, it was built in. Then it was discontinued. Then revived with the totally different system that we have today.

      Interix became integrated as a component of the regular Windows OS distribution as a component of Windows Server 2003 R2 in December, 2005 at release 5.2 and was a component of the Windows Vista release as release 6.0 (RTM November, 2006). Windows Server 2008 had release 6.0. Windows 7 and Windows Server 2008 R2 included SUA 6.1. - wikipedia
